>>>>In VFP this works great, I'm able to access the child's object properties & methods, but as a com object called from a .Net c# project the properties & methos of thos child's objects are not available.
>
>This is probably because you don't have information about your "child" objects in the COM Type Library. Without this information, C# can't see the child object and as a strongly-typed language, it will not let you compile code trying to access what it can't see as valid type.
